Street Fighter II: The World Warrior
Few franchises hit the sweet spot between nostalgia and excitement quite like Street Fighter II. The slot version takes the energy of those 1991 arcade duels and gives it a new twist, swapping button-mashing for clever spins. The 5×5 cluster pay setup makes every round feel alive.
Pick Ryu, and you might see stacked wilds dropping in to keep the wins steady. Go with Chun-Li, and random wilds might hit the reels at unexpected moments, turning an average spin into something worth leaning in for.
The avalanche mechanic keeps the action rolling. Winning clusters disappear, new symbols drop in, and the chain reactions can keep building, especially with the health bar system above the reels.
With a 96.06% RTP, medium-to-high volatility, and wins topping 7,000x your stake, there’s plenty of bite beneath the retro look. The pixel art and arcade sound effects seal the deal, letting you relive the glory days without a joystick in sight.
Tomb Raider: Temples and Tombs
This slot leans into the thrill of the hunt. Inspired by Lara Croft’s endless chases for lost treasures, it drops players deep into crumbling temples, shadowy corridors, and the promise of jackpots waiting to be uncovered. The 5-reel layout with 243 ways to win keeps every spin packed with possibilities, and the rolling reels mechanic makes the whole thing feel like an adventure in motion.
The symbols bring the theme to life: grappling hooks, ancient artifacts, flickering torches, and of course, Lara in mid-action. Scarab wilds are the real prize here – collect enough during a sequence and you could trigger one of three jackpots, with the grand topping out at 5,000x your bet. Combined with a 96.05% RTP and high volatility, the game delivers on both story and payout potential.
It’s built for mobile as much as desktop, so the same rush of chasing a big win in a hidden chamber works just as well on the train as it does at home.
Aviator
Aviator breaks away from the traditional slot mold entirely. There are no reels, no paylines – just a rising multiplier and a plane on the climb. This game was inspired by those old-school arcades you could find at local pubs.
You place your bet, watch the number climb from 1x upwards, and decide when to cash out before the plane disappears. It’s simple in concept, but in execution, it’s a constant tug-of-war between greed and timing.
What sets Aviator apart is its use of provably fair technology. Live stats show other players’ cash-out points in real time, creating that multiplayer arcade feel where you can’t help but glance at what everyone else is doing.
